Home
last modified time | relevance | path

Searched refs:hashalg (Results 1 – 5 of 5) sorted by relevance

/freebsd/crypto/openssh/
H A Dsshsig.c164 sshsig_wrap_sign(struct sshkey *key, const char *hashalg, in sshsig_wrap_sign() argument
186 (r = sshbuf_put_cstring(tosign, hashalg)) != 0 || in sshsig_wrap_sign()
217 (r = sshbuf_put_cstring(blob, hashalg)) != 0 || in sshsig_wrap_sign()
258 sshsig_check_hashalg(const char *hashalg) in sshsig_check_hashalg() argument
260 if (hashalg == NULL || in sshsig_check_hashalg()
261 match_pattern_list(hashalg, HASHALG_ALLOWED, 0) == 1) in sshsig_check_hashalg()
263 error_f("unsupported hash algorithm \"%.100s\"", hashalg); in sshsig_check_hashalg()
271 char *hashalg = NULL; in sshsig_peek_hashalg() local
283 (r = sshbuf_get_cstring(buf, &hashalg, NULL)) != 0 || in sshsig_peek_hashalg()
291 *hashalgp = hashalg; in sshsig_peek_hashalg()
[all …]
H A Dsshsig.h37 int sshsig_signb(struct sshkey *key, const char *hashalg,
58 int sshsig_sign_fd(struct sshkey *key, const char *hashalg,
H A Dssh-keyscan.c85 int hashalg = -1; /* Hash for SSHFP records or -1 for all */ variable
325 export_dns_rr(host, key, stdout, 0, hashalg); in keyprint_one()
747 if ((hashalg = ssh_digest_alg_by_name( in main()
H A Dssh-keygen.c2611 const char *sig_namespace, const char *hashalg, sshsig_signer *signer, in sign_one() argument
2642 if ((r = sshsig_sign_fd(signkey, hashalg, sk_provider, pin, in sign_one()
2753 char *hashalg = NULL; in sig_sign() local
2763 if (sig_process_opts(opts, nopts, &hashalg, NULL, NULL) != 0) in sig_sign()
2797 sig_namespace, hashalg, signer, &agent_fd)) != 0) in sig_sign()
2809 hashalg, signer, &agent_fd)) != 0) in sig_sign()
2823 free(hashalg); in sig_sign()
/freebsd/crypto/openssl/providers/common/der/
H A Dder_rsa_key.c289 const unsigned char *hashalg = NULL; in ossl_DER_w_RSASSA_PSS_params() local
337 OAEP_PSS_MD_CASE(sha1, hashalg); in ossl_DER_w_RSASSA_PSS_params()
338 OAEP_PSS_MD_CASE(sha224, hashalg); in ossl_DER_w_RSASSA_PSS_params()
339 OAEP_PSS_MD_CASE(sha256, hashalg); in ossl_DER_w_RSASSA_PSS_params()
340 OAEP_PSS_MD_CASE(sha384, hashalg); in ossl_DER_w_RSASSA_PSS_params()
341 OAEP_PSS_MD_CASE(sha512, hashalg); in ossl_DER_w_RSASSA_PSS_params()
342 OAEP_PSS_MD_CASE(sha512_224, hashalg); in ossl_DER_w_RSASSA_PSS_params()
343 OAEP_PSS_MD_CASE(sha512_256, hashalg); in ossl_DER_w_RSASSA_PSS_params()
354 || ossl_DER_w_precompiled(pkt, 0, hashalg, hashalg_sz)) in ossl_DER_w_RSASSA_PSS_params()